ROSWELL WOMAN'S CLUB INC, founded in 1948, is a small nonprofit in the Community Improvement sector that reported $214K in total revenue in fiscal year 2024. Expenses of $196K left a modest 8% surplus.

Mission

THE ROSWELL WOMAN'S CLUB IS AN ALL-VOLUNTEER, NOT-FOR-PROFIT SERVICE ORGANIZATION WHOSE COMMON INTEREST IS TO SUPPORT OUR COMMUNITY IN THE AREAS OF EDUCATIONAL SCHOLARSHIPS AND GRANTS, HUMAN SERVICES, CULTURAL ARTS, HISTORICAL PRESERVATION, AND URBAN IMPROVEMENT. OUR DEDICATED MEMBERSHIP ACCOMPLISHES THIS THROUGH HANDS-ON INVOLVEMENT, VOLUNTEERISM IN THE COMMUNITY AND MONETARY CONTRIBUTIONS THROUGH FUND RAISING.
